What's a contact resistance tester? It's a handy tool used to measure the resistance at the contact points of electrical components. It sends a known current through the contact and then measures the voltage drop across it. Using Ohm's Law (yep, that old classic: V = IR), we can then calculate the resistance.

Now, let's talk about railway electrical equipment. Railways are a complex web of electrical systems. There are the power supply lines that bring electricity to the trains, the signaling systems that keep everything running safely, and the various electrical components on the trains themselves, like motors and control units. All these parts rely on good electrical connections, and that's where contact resistance comes in.

A high contact resistance can lead to a whole bunch of problems. It can cause overheating, which can damage the equipment and even start a fire. It can also lead to voltage drops, which can affect the performance of the electrical systems. So, being able to measure the contact resistance accurately is crucial for maintaining the safety and efficiency of railway electrical equipment.

But it's not just about having the right tool. When measuring the resistance of railway electrical equipment, there are a few things to keep in mind. First, the environment can be quite harsh. There's a lot of vibration, dust, and moisture on the railway tracks. Our testers are built to withstand these conditions, but it's still important to take proper care of them.

Second, the electrical connections in railway equipment can be complex. There may be multiple layers of insulation and different types of conductors. It's important to follow the proper testing procedures to ensure accurate results. For example, make sure the contacts are clean and free of any dirt or corrosion before taking a measurement.

Third, safety is always a top priority. When working on railway electrical systems, you're dealing with high voltages and currents. Make sure you follow all the safety regulations and wear the appropriate protective gear.
